§ 13 §2867 — No compulsion; withdrawals
A person described in section 2866 may not be a member of a parish or religious society without the person's consent. A person may dissolve that person's connection with a parish or religious society by leaving with its clerk a certificate of the person's intention to do so, and all the person's liability for future expenses ceases; but the person may be taxed for money previously raised, except in case of removal from a local parish.
